Why Lemon-Ginger Juice?
Lemon-ginger juice is known for its bright citrus flavor combined with the spicy warmth of ginger. It is naturally refreshing, aids digestion, and helps cut through the richness of stir-fried dishes. Its tangy profile pairs well with the complex flavors of Asian cuisine.
Perfect Pairings for Spicy Dishes
- Stir-fried Sichuan Chicken: The citrus notes of lemon-ginger juice balance the numbing spice of Sichuan peppercorns.
- Pad Thai: The tangy and spicy flavors are complemented by the refreshing zest of lemon and ginger.
- Spicy Tofu Stir-fry: The drink’s brightness helps mellow the heat and enhances the umami flavors.
Tips for Serving
For the best experience, serve lemon-ginger juice chilled. Add a few slices of fresh lemon and ginger for garnish. You can also infuse the juice with a touch of honey or mint for extra flavor. This beverage is versatile and can be prepared ahead of time for quick serving.
